CS 6290 - Cryptography and Data Security



Credit Hour(s): 3
Mathematical principles of cryptography and data security. Preliminary algebra and number theory will be briefly introduced. Various developments in cryptography will then be discussed, including the data encryption standard (DES), public-key encryption (RSA), cryptographic hash functions, digital signatures, key safeguarding schemes, and cryptographic protocols such as key exchange and entity authentication, identification schemes, electronic elections and digital cash.
